BAE Systems receives Mk 38 coaxial kits order
BAE Systems Land and Armaments will supply Mk 38 Machine Gun System coaxial kits to the US Naval Surface Warfare Center under an order announced on 12 September.
The company will supply materials and services to manufacture, assemble, inspect, preserve, package and ship coaxial kits to support operations and maintenance for the MK38 Machine Gun Systems used by the US Navy and Coast Guard.
Work will run through December 2020.
